In season 18 episode 13 of How It's Made, viewers are taken on a tour of three fascinating industries as they explore the making of traffic signal poles, coffee filters, and chainsaw mining machines.

The episode begins by showcasing how traffic signal poles are made. Viewers are transported inside a factory where workers bend and shape metal pipes into the classic pole shape. The poles are then galvanized to prevent rust and painted with reflective paint to increase visibility at night. The process is a delicate one where any imperfection could compromise the safety of drivers and pedestrians on the road.

Next, the episode dives into the world of coffee filters. Viewers get an up-close look at how this everyday item is made from start to finish. They enter a factory where they witness how raw materials are transformed into the final product. The coffee filter manufacturing process involves huge rolls of paper that are fed into large machines, stamped with the characteristic scalloped edges, and then cut into precise shapes. The filters are then packaged and shipped out to coffee lovers all around the world.

In the final segment of the show, viewers are taken into the world of chainsaw mining machines. These incredible machines are used to extract precious minerals from deep within the earth. The episode zeros in on how these machines are put together from start to finish. Viewers are treated to never before seen footage of the machines in action as they dig through layers of earth and rock, all while keeping the operator safe. The process of building these machines requires a highly skilled workforce and an incredible amount of innovation.
